ENGL 1300 - Introduction to Creative Writing
3 Credits This course introduces students to the fundamentals of creative writing. the focus is on fiction and poetry; nonfiction and screenwriting may be covered as well.
Major Content Areas Create believable fictional plots. Create believable fictional dialogue. Describe settings vividly in fiction. Work with symbolism and metaphors in figurative language. Work with figurative language allusion. Work with poetry rhyme. Work with poetry rhythm.
Learning Outcomes Demonstrate descriptive writing skills. Use effective sentence structure. Organize their writing effectively.
Minnesota Transfer Curriculum (MNTC) Goals 06 - Humanities/Fine Arts 01 - Communication
